Mark_center is a small callback that puts a cross at the center of space, where the camera is pointing.
You could also use this to setup arbitrary CGOs (points, lines, etc) in 3D space.
from pymol import cmd
def crosshair_put_center():
t = cmd.get_position()
m = [1, 0, 0, t[0], 0, 1, 0, t[1], 0, 0, 1, t[2], 0, 0, 0, 1]
cmd.set_object_ttt('crosshair', m, homogenous=1)
cmd.load_callback(crosshair_put_center, '_crosshair_cb')
cmd.pseudoatom('crosshair', pos=(0,0,0))
cmd.show_as('nonbonded', 'crosshair')
